gpt4 book ai didi

string - 变量没有在 Perl 字符串中扩展?

转载 作者:行者123 更新时间:2023-12-01 15:16:52 25 4
gpt4 key购买 nike

我正在尝试使用下一个代码复制一个 png 文件

$cty2 = 'filename';
fwrite($fh, $stringData);
$old = 'images/bg_freeze.png';
$new = 'images/$cty2.png';
copy($old, $new) or die("Unable to copy $old to $new.");
fclose($fh);

但是,结果是一个具有此名称的 png 文件($cty2.png)它应该是 ( filename.png )

我如何解决它使新文件名 ( filename.png ) 而不是 ( $cty2.png )

最佳答案

您还没有指定是哪种语言。但问题几乎可以肯定是你需要使用双引号("),而不是单引号(')。否则变量将不会在字符串内部展开。

关于string - 变量没有在 Perl 字符串中扩展?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10711568/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com